Q: Is 9,724,979 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 9,724,979 is a composite number.

Why is 9,724,979 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 9,724,979 can be evenly divided by 1 11 19 31 79 209 341 361 589 869 1,501 2,449 3,971 6,479 11,191 16,511 26,939 28,519 46,531 123,101 313,709 511,841 884,089 and 9,724,979, with no remainder.

Since 9,724,979 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,724,979, it is a composite number.
